你查询的IP:[117.22.62.140]  地理位置:中国–陕西–西安

最新查询119.48.162.21 117.60.44.83 118.180.92.90 59.80.149.105 219.82.103.96 122.64.102.10 123.112.180.233 116.207.15.12 210.51.137.87 117.22.62.140 202.149.160.64 202.91.128.68 219.224.122.93 119.176.146.185 218.23.72.0 60.247.42.205 210.79.224.211 61.87.192.167 119.62.107.189 203.91.96.75 121.89.36.114 117.8.53.134 121.58.119.108 203.119.24.171 119.148.160.232 116.8.244.162 123.196.132.196 118.184.53.115 117.24.37.223 202.38.64.216 119.27.64.68